TURN-208: Gatevale turnstile counters at the Merrow Field pilot double-count when a rotation reverses mid-cycle. Attendance totals drift roughly 2% high per event. The debounce window fix is implemented, reviewed by Ilsa, and soak-tested across two simulated match days without drift. Ready for your cut; the candidate build is identified below.

trace token, tagag-tafog: htk6_5ed18c

Subject: Weather fan-out key rotation

Per the quarterly schedule, the Stormrelay fan-out service credential was rotated today. Scope is unchanged (`alerts.publish` only), old key revoked, audit log attached to the ticket. No consumer-side changes needed. For your verification records, the new credential is the key below.

API key for kahop-bagef: zpat2_yb

Leadership Review Briefing — Sales Leads

Subject: customer-support outsourcing at Kestrel Freight Systems. Proposal: move tier-one support to Avandel Services, operating from their Merrowgate center, over two quarters. Expected savings of roughly a third on support costs; response-time targets stay contractual. In-house team retains escalations and key accounts, so your client relationships are unaffected. Transition risks and staffing impacts were reviewed and accepted. The commercial rationale is summarized below.

board note of yajeg-yaweg: The pricing group signed off on a budget of $4.9 million for Project Quenix. The renewal with Sormirek Freight closes at $6.1 million a year, 37 percent below the last contract.

## Account Recovery — Trailnote Offline Mode

When a surveyor's Trailnote app has been offline for 30+ days, their local credentials expire and sync refuses to resume. Don't make them wipe the device — all their unsynced field data lives there! Instead, open the support console, pick "Offline Reinstate," and enter their handle. The console will ask for the support team's shared recovery passphrase before issuing a reinstatement token. Use the one below.

unlock words, bagaf-fajeg: zorael-kelax-fraath-quenix-eliok-sileth-aldmir-wenir-druiel